About DW Windsor

DW Windsor is a leading designer and manufacturer of exterior lighting solutions, helping create safer, more attractive and sustainable public spaces throughout the UK.

Our products illuminate streets, public realm developments, transport infrastructure, residential schemes and commercial environments, combining performance, innovation and design excellence.

The Role

As NPD & Product Lifecycle Manager, you will lead the strategic development and ongoing management of our lighting portfolio, acting as the link between engineering, sales, marketing, operations and customers.

You will use market intelligence, customer insight and commercial analysis to identify opportunities, define product roadmaps and successfully deliver new products to market while optimising the performance of existing ranges.

Key Responsibilities

  • Own and deliver the product roadmap across multiple lighting product categories.
  • Lead New Product Development (NPD) projects from concept through to commercial launch.
  • Manage products throughout the entire lifecycle including introduction, growth, maturity, rationalisation and replacement.
  • Identify market opportunities through customer feedback, market research and competitor analysis.
  • Work closely with engineering and technical teams to develop innovative, commercially viable solutions.
  • Define product requirements, specifications and business cases for new developments.
  • Own product positioning, pricing strategy, profitability and commercial performance.
  • Support successful product launches through effective cross-functional planning and execution.
  • Engage regularly with customers, consultants, contractors, specifiers and industry stakeholders.
  • Ensure products comply with relevant industry standards, certifications and legislative requirements.
  • Drive sustainability, innovation and continuous improvement initiatives across the product portfolio.
  • Deliver product training and technical support to commercial teams.

About You

We're looking for a commercially minded and technically capable product professional who enjoys turning market opportunities into successful physical products.

Essential Experience

  • Proven Product Management, NPD or Product Lifecycle Management experience within a manufacturing, engineering or technical product environment.
  • Experience managing physical products from concept and development through to launch and lifecycle management.
  • Strong commercial awareness with experience managing product performance and profitability.
  • Experience working closely with engineering, operations, supply chain and commercial teams.
  • Ability to interpret technical specifications and translate customer needs into product requirements.
  • Strong analytical, project management and stakeholder engagement skills.
  • Excellent communication and presentation abilities.
